Understanding GLP-1 Weight Loss Medications and Your Options

GLP-1 receptor agonists work by slowing stomach emptying, increasing fullness signals to the brain, and reducing hunger hormones—three mechanisms that together help control appetite and food intake. Semaglutide and tirzepatide are the two primary active compounds in compounded weight loss therapy; tirzepatide also activates GIP receptors, adding a fourth pathway that may amplify results for certain patients. Frequently Asked Questions

Is compounded semaglutide the same as brand-name Ozempic?

Compounded semaglutide contains the same active ingredient as Ozempic but is made by licensed 503A pharmacies rather than manufactured by a pharmaceutical company. How much weight do people typically lose with GLP-1 therapy?

Clinical trials show semaglutide users lose 10–15% of body weight over 68 weeks, while tirzepatide users lose 15–22% across similar timeframes. What side effects should I expect from GLP-1 therapy?

Common side effects include mild nausea, vomiting, constipation, or reduced appetite—most mild and temporary during the first 1–2 weeks.
